Barcelona forward Lionel Messi has been presented with his third Golden Boot award for scoring the most goals in Europe's domestic leagues last season.

The 26-year-old Messi helped Barcelona win the 2012-13 Spanish league title by scoring 46 goals despite missing several games with a right hamstring pull near the end of the season.

Messi also won the award for the 2011-12 season when he set a Spanish league record with 50 goals. The Argentina international earned his first Golden Boot for the 2009-10 season when his 34 goals help Barcelona to the league title.

Messi is recovering from a left hamstring tear that will probably keep him sidelined for the rest of 2013. Before his injury, he had scored eight goals in 11 league appearances.
